A driver has been charged with a number of offences after police stopped him in the middle of the night.

Dean Clark, 57, was arrested in Market Place, Wisbech, just after midnight after providing a breath sample of 47 – the legal limit is 35 microgrammes of alcohol in 100ml of breath.

He has since been charged with drink driving, as well as being in possession of a knife in a public place and cannabis.

Clark, of West Parade in Wisbech, has been bailed to appear at Peterborough Magistrates’ Court on 22 March.
